Introduction

Whether or not to allow a sister or daughter to be intimate with her boyfriend is a personal decision that should be made by the individual and her family. There is no right or wrong answer, and the best decision will vary depending on the circumstances. Some factors to consider include the age and maturity of the individuals involved, the nature of their relationship, and the family’s values and beliefs. Ultimately, the decision should be made in the best interests of the individual and her well-being.

Communication and Trust

In the realm of communication and trust, the topic of intimacy between siblings or daughters and their boyfriends raises complex questions. As parents or guardians, we grapple with the responsibility of guiding our loved ones through these sensitive matters.

While it is natural for young people to explore romantic relationships, it is crucial to establish clear boundaries and expectations. Open and honest communication is paramount in fostering a healthy and respectful environment. By engaging in age-appropriate conversations, we can help our children understand the importance of consent, safety, and emotional well-being.

It is essential to recognize that intimacy is a personal choice that should be made by the individuals involved. However, as parents, we have a duty to provide guidance and support. We can encourage our children to make informed decisions by discussing the potential risks and benefits of engaging in intimate relationships.

Furthermore, it is important to respect our children’s privacy while also maintaining an open line of communication. By creating a safe and non-judgmental space, we can encourage them to come to us with any questions or concerns they may have.

It is also crucial to address the issue of consent. Our children should understand that they have the right to say no to any form of intimacy they are not comfortable with. We must emphasize that consent is not just about saying yes but also about respecting the boundaries of others.

By fostering open communication, establishing clear boundaries, and respecting our children’s choices, we can help them navigate the complexities of intimacy in a healthy and responsible manner. It is through these conversations that we build trust and create a foundation for lifelong relationships based on respect and understanding.
